New mayor chooses Foodbank charity and town-rural integration
Cawston's Carolyn Watson-Merret was elected as mayor today
By Eleanor Holdsworth
ADMIRALS & Cawston councillor Carolyn Watson-Merret (Conservative) was today (Thursday 19th May 2022) elected as mayor for Rugby 2022-23.
The unanimous vote took place at the full Rugby Borough Council meeting in the council’s chambers - the first time since the pandemic struck.
The new mayor chose Rugby Food Bank for her charity and said her theme for the year would be integrating the town and rural communities of the borough.
On choosing a charity, Cllr Watson-Merret said: “There are many deserving charities and it’s not been an easy choice. I make my charity this year Rugby Food Bank.
“When people of Rugby and the surrounding villages are making difficult decisions between heating or eating, and recently the empty shelves at Rugby Foodbank were making headlines, then I know that it’s time to do more.”
She went on to describe how she had been inspired by the Seva community group.
